2025 NNPC/Chevron Nigeria Limited JV Scholarship Awards: Link to Apply and Requirements

Chevron Nigeria Limited (CNL) in collaboration with its Joint Venture (JV) partner, the Nigerian National Petroleum Company Limited (NNPCL), is offering a number of University Scholarship Awards to suitably qualified Nigerian students from all States of the Federation. The scholarship program is a major component of our strategic social investment in the development of education in Nigeria.

Chevron Undergraduate Scholarship Eligible Courses

  • Accountancy
  • Agricultural Science
  • Architecture
  • Business Administration
  • Business and Economics
  • Computer Science
  • Dentistry
  • Engineering
  • Environmental Studies/Surveying
  • Geo informatics
  • Geology
  • Geophysics
  • Law
  • Mass Communication/Journalism
  • Medicine & Surgery
  • Pharmacy

Requisite Requirements Needed To Be Eligible For Chevron Undergraduate Scholarship

There are mandatory requirements applicants must possess to be eligible. Below are some of the mandatory requirements:

Applicants must: 

  • Have a minimum Cumulative Grade Point Average (CGPA) of 3.5 in a 5.0 grade system or the equivalent in other grade systems.
  • Have a minimum of six O-level credits in one sitting.
  • Full-time, SECOND YEAR (200 LEVEL) degree students studying any of the selected  courses in Nigerian Universities

Application Documents

Before you begin the application process, ensure you have clear scanned copies of the following documents

  • Passport photograph not more than 6 months old (450px by 450px not more than 200kb)
  • School ID card
  • Admission Letter
  • Birth Certificate
  • O’ Level Result
  • JAMB Result
  • Local Government Area Letter of Identification

Ensure the documents are named according to what they represent to avoid mixing up documents during upload.
Ensure you attach the appropriate documents when asked to upload.

Application Deadline

The management of NNPC/CHEVRON scholarship board has announced June 30, 2025 as the latest closing date for the application of the 2025 NNPC/Chevron Nigeria Limited JV Scholarship Awards.

How to Apply

Interested and qualified? Go to Chevron Nigeria on candidate.scholastica.ng to apply

Visit Scholastica.ng webpage

Follow the Step-by-step guidelines below to successfully apply:

1.    Click on “Apply Now” tab.
2.    Click on “Register Now” to create an account.
3.    Proceed to your email box to activate your account
4.    Click on https://candidate.scholastica.ng/schemes/2025CNLawards to return to Scholarship site
5.    Enter your registered email and password to upload your information.
6.    Enter your personal information, National Identification Number (if available), educational information, other information and upload required scanned documents.
7.    Ensure the name used in applications matches the names on all documentation in same order. Upload a sworn affidavit or certificate if otherwise.
8.    Ensure you view all documents after uploading, to eliminate errors during uploading.
9.    When asked to upload photo, upload a passport photograph with a white background.
10.  Recheck application information to avoid errors
11.  Return to “Active Scholarships” and Click on the scheme you wish to apply and Click “Apply Now” to submit information
12.  You will receive a notification displayed on the screen and via email that you have successfully applied. To confirm Check “My application” under “My account” section on your profile account.
13.  Return to www.scholastica.ng, enter your Email and Password to download your profile and proceed to have your Head of Department sign the document.
14.  Upload a scanned copy of the signed profile, this would be used for verification.
15.  If National Identification Number (NIN) number was not available in step 6, to obtain your National Identification Number (NIN)

  • Visit http://ninenrol.gov.ng to register and learn more about the National Identity Number
  • Click “Create Account” and fill in the required  fields
  • Login with Email and Password to complete the form
  • After completion, schedule a date for photo and finger print capture
  • Visit any of the 37 capture centres http://www.nimc.gov.ng/?q=nin-registration-centres  to complete the registration process and obtain your National Identity Number
  • You can also do your total registration at the NIMC office

16. Return to www.scholastica.ng and update application with National Identification Number (NIN) to ensure completion

Note: Multiple applications may attract a disqualification penalty from the Scholarship board. So you are advice to apply ones.
